How to create your own Trading Cards
What you need:
Cardstock/Chipboard
Paper
Scissors/paper cutter
Paint
Glue
Embellishments
Instructions:
1. Cut a sheet of cardstock or chipboard into rectangles that measure 2.5 inches by 3.5 inches.
2. Cover the front and back of each cardstock or chipboard rectangle with decorative paper or paint your own background design instead.
3. Use glue to attach a photograph or focal point on the front of each card. This can be a picture of you, nature or perhaps a replica photo of completed artwork. Consider using a small, lightweight item such as a bottle cap, seashell or a coin as the focal point instead of a photograph.
4. Embellish the trading cards with light objects such as stamps, brads, eyelets, paper clips or even paper clay decorations.
5. Add words to the front or back of the trading cards. This could be a phrase, poem, title or even information about the artist.
